Dwayne Musselman, 63, Passed Away

LAKE WORTH, FL (Boca Post) (Copyright © 2024) — Dwayne Musselman of Lake Worth passed away after being run over by his own, unoccupied truck.

PBSO and PBCFR responded to Dwayne’s home on the 3000 block of Buccaneer Road in suburban Lake Worth just before 1 PM on Monday, January 15th, 2024.

According to PBSO, Dwayne Kenneth Musselman was operating a 2006 Chevy Silverado on private property. He had used the truck to remove a large stump from the ground. Unfortunately, the truck wasn’t properly put into “park” mode. While Musselman was standing outside the driver’s side of the truck, it unexpectedly started rolling downhill with the driver door open. As it continued to roll backward, the door struck Musselman and caused him to fall to the ground. Tragically, he was then tragically run over by the front of the truck. First responders pronounced Musselman deceased at the scene.
